The Magic Faraway Tree is a charming tale about three siblings Joe, Beth and Frannie and their cousin Rick (previously named Dick) who venture to the Enchanted Woods and the Faraway Tree. A climb to the top of the tree takes you to mystical lands such as Topsy-Turvey Land, Land of Spells and Land of Do-As-You-Please.
However, things aren't all plain sailing, and we find our young heroes
consistantly in dangerous situations that look completely unescapable.
These frightening scenarios bring tension and mayhem to feed the
readers anticipation of what will happen next.
With the help of the other hugely descriptive characters in the story
like Moon-Face, Silky the Fairy and Saucepan Man to guide them through
the troubled waters and to safety. At one point in the story, the
children think that they have had enough of the Faraway Tree after a
very close-call, but not surprisingly, soon find that they can't stay
away from the lands that offer untold delights.
The Magic Faraway Tree is such a classic tale and a great introduction
for young readers. Readers will find that every page contains some
magic, spice or mystery that will fuel the imagination. Enid Blyton's
masterfully telling of this story really stays with you for
years and years after you have read it.
